21CTO
Mar 12, 2016 · Backend Development
Designing Scalable Asynchronous Message Queues: Ctrip’s Hermes Architecture Deep Dive
This article examines Ctrip's Hermes asynchronous messaging system, detailing its evolution from a simple Mongo‑backed queue to a broker‑centric, partitioned architecture with lease‑based cluster management, and shares practical techniques for building high‑performance, low‑latency message queues in large‑scale distributed environments.
Backend ArchitectureDistributed SystemsHermes
0 likes · 21 min read
